> Yeah, I think David's examples are talking about the behavior of join, > but we're trying to decide what split should do. I think the main > argument for making it return NULL is that you can then fairly easily > use COALESCE() to get whatever you want. That's a bit more difficult > if you use return any other value.
I think that there's a need for additional built-in array functions, including one to succinctly test if an array has no elements. Iterating through an array with plpgsql, for example, is more clunky than it should be. -- Regards, Peter Geoghegan -- Sent via pgsql-hackers mailing list (pgsql-hackers@postgresql.org) To make changes to your subscription: http://www.postgresql.org/mailpref/pgsql-hackers